= Capacity Decision: Verlane Works (Managers Only) =

Summary for the finance team. Following the Q2 review, Brightmoor Industries will consolidate extrusion output at the Verlane Works and idle two lines at Kestrel Point. Expected annual savings: mid-single-digit percentage of plant opex. Severance and retooling costs land in the next two quarters; model both scenarios. Utilisation targets revised upward. The rationale is set out in the confidential note below.

confidential, kagep-kahof: Druokax Systems plans to lower the Ulaath list price by 53 percent in March.

Handover Note — Directors' Transition

As I hand the Pellmore franchise portfolio to Ines Varga, the key item is the pending agreement with Thistledown Provisions covering three outlets in the Calderby district. Terms are agreed in principle: seven-year initial period, standard royalty structure, fit-out funded by the franchisee. Legal review concludes this month. Department heads should route related queries to Ines from Monday. The wider expansion context is captured in the confidential note below.

management briefing: The pricing group signed off on a budget of $378.8 million for Project Kasael.

// SCRUB_PROFILE_DEFAULT
//
// Plugin authors: this constant selects the EXIF scrubbing profile
// applied by the Pictrel upload pipeline before your plugin sees the
// image. GPS, serial-number, and owner tags are stripped; orientation
// and color-space tags are preserved. Do not attempt to re-read raw
// EXIF downstream — it is gone by design. The scrubber build this
// default was validated against is identified by the token below.

build token for kagaf-hahof: htk14_9d3d4d26d7d8de